They would count against next year's cap until the first game of the season or they signed a letter to the league saying that they would not be coming over (which is extremely unlikely).  In the event that they did sign such a letter, they would be replaced by a minimum salary slot (since you need a minimum of 12 spots accounted for on the roster)

It has an important effect on the payroll as far as cap space goes

Source (emphasis mine):
Quote
If a first round pick signs with a non-NBA team, his scale amount is excluded from the team salary on the date he signs his non-NBA contract or the first day of the regular season, whichever is later. The scale amount goes back onto the team salary on the following July 1 or when his non-NBA contract ends, whichever is earlier. In other words, these cap holds are removed for players playing outside the NBA, but only during the regular season.
